Does anyone know the best way to decrease the size of a 350mb avi file to around 320mb.
I have a bunch of videos to put on DVD that add up to 4.44gb but the DVD can only take 4.38.
So if anyone knows how to do this. The file is xvid avi.

Tried zipping it?
Or you could convert it to another file format, like mp4 or rmvb(i think)

Or if you want to reduce the file size and you don't mind if the quality is a little damaged, you could try reducing the bitrate, or even the videos scale size.
